Solution for 4(3+x)-x=6(x+2) equation:


Simplifying
4(3 + x) + -1x = 6(x + 2)
(3 * 4 + x * 4) + -1x = 6(x + 2)
(12 + 4x) + -1x = 6(x + 2)

Combine like terms: 4x + -1x = 3x
12 + 3x = 6(x + 2)

Reorder the terms:
12 + 3x = 6(2 + x)
12 + 3x = (2 * 6 + x * 6)
12 + 3x = (12 + 6x)

Add '-12' to each side of the equation.
12 + -12 + 3x = 12 + -12 + 6x

Combine like terms: 12 + -12 = 0
0 + 3x = 12 + -12 + 6x
3x = 12 + -12 + 6x

Combine like terms: 12 + -12 = 0
3x = 0 + 6x
3x = 6x

Solving
3x = 6x

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-6x' to each side of the equation.
3x + -6x = 6x + -6x

Combine like terms: 3x + -6x = -3x
-3x = 6x + -6x

Combine like terms: 6x + -6x = 0
-3x = 0

Divide each side by '-3'.
x = 0

Simplifying
x = 0
